Don't disagree with anything you said except the legislative stuff. Constituent work has helped out a lot of folks, not necessarily legislative, but congressional casework by young underpaid staffers who often are told to help without regard to party affiliation do amazing things. Pulled a few myself, but basically it is all grunt work, not pretty, but the undeserved thank you letters I received were inspiring. Legislation is another thing and I agree whole heartedly with the above statement, with one more exception because friends and family being sent to war and being put in harms way without a good honest reason.
